About U. Buoncristianí

U. Buoncristianí is a scholar working on Nephrology, Clinical Biochemistry and Emergency Medical Services, having authored 93 papers that have together received 2.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Dialysis and Renal Disease Management (56 papers), Central Venous Catheters and Hemodialysis (10 papers) and Neurological and metabolic disorders (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nephrology (1.9k citations), Emergency Medical Services (627 citations) and Clinical Biochemistry (211 citations). U. Buoncristianí has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Lebanon. Frequent co-authors include Francesco Galli, Franco Canestrari, Riccardo Maria Fagugli, Giuseppe Quintaliani, S. Rovidati, Ardesio Floridi, G. Ciao, Serena Benedetti, Paolo Pasini and Franca Pasticci.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Annals of the New York Academy of Sciences and Kidney International.
